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5325654 474816 59 50342822 05
12897261 45467
12897261 45467
9110578763 524 2398 04784811075
All about undefined
Interested in learning more?
12897261 45467
9110578763 524 2398 04784811075
See more
60 42966
6180 9856 14591 991
See more
137158 752 155155
7288 412 0183784118
See more